A bartender at a chain restaurant gave me their margarita recipe. It’s the perfect combo… and very dangerous.
Ingredients
- 1½ oz. Sauza Gold tequila
- ½ oz. Gran Gala (its a kind of orange liquer)
- ½ oz. Cointreau (ditto)
- 2½ oz. sour mix
- Juice of half a lime
- Ice
- Coarse Salt
Directions
- Rim margarita glass with salt. (Hint, instead of plunking the whole rim in the salt dish, I just pat the outside in the salt so it stays on the rim and not in the drink). Fill with ice.
- In a shaker filled with ice, combine tequila, Cointreau, Gran Gala, lime juice, and sour mix. Shake and strain over rocks in the margarita glass.
- Repeat as necessary.
